A note on the symmetry thing:

I think resource-efficiency contests like these (going by the 300K contests I've done in the past) tend to breed symmetry maps. It's a lot easier to make your brushes and texture palettes perform double duty. But yeah, it has its limits. papercoffee wrote:download/file.php?id=5383 not good?
Actually, the image is very nice, except it is 256 x 256 - and when i import this image into MyLevel it becomes somehow larger than the 29k filesaize it shows in windows explorer... in fact, if i export the image from the texture browser it becomes 64k. So this is causing my map to go to 523K. If i use just a 128 x 128 image
with a filesize of 11k then my map is 475k. Pretty weird, eh? So i reduced the 256x256 version to 128x128 and this works fine, except it looks like shit in unreal lol!

Dunno what's going on here - the 256 x 256 version reduced on the surface to .5 (so it's 128x128) looks nice and clear. The externally reduced version 128x128 on the surface as 1.0 looks like crap... !? i really don't want to delete any more stuff out of the map ... can you help me?
